AIA Southside Massive End of Season Party
 

The Liechtenstein Princely Navy was invited to attend AIA Southside Massive’s End of Season Party at the Royal Hong Kong Yacht Club. The theme was about gorillas and bananas, which was also reflected in the decoration around the pool. The Navy stuck to protocol and attended in matching “NAVY” post race uniforms instead.

Before long, members of various teams were found in the swimming pool, including Sailors Kaspar, Ruedi and LiechtenSteve, who used to occasion to engage various bikini-clad female targets in the vicinity. Usually calm and placid Sailor Ruedi was not amused about being thrown into the pool and cause a minor diplomatic incident by taking a member of a rival team into headlock – thus leaving up to his family name (Wildi = the Wild One).

Sailor Kaspar was also in his element, floating up and down the pool in his Armani jeans while clinging to his inflatable banana and trying to compete with Sailor LiechtenSteve for the attention of the under-dressed ladies. SOF James eventually also volunteered a jump into the pool while the Admiralty was directing proceedings from a dry distance.

The party featured the usual drinking competition, whereby AIA Southside Massive predictably jumped the start and the HKIPC spilled the beer across the floor. The Navy had a strong race despite the inferior non-Foster’s quality of the fuel.

Aside from celebrating the end of a long dragon boat season, the event was also raising money for a children’s foundation, which the Navy supported by hosting a Best Liechtenstein Song Competition. Contestants were judged in their ability to sing the most recognized anthem in dragon boating – the “Liechtenstein” song – while offering $100 for charity for each contestant. We heard some fantastic – and some horrendous – renditions of our beloved anthem, including a rap version, a can-can, a “Like a Virgin” Madonna version and a Swedish version that did not even mention Liechtenstein. After long deliberations, the judges awarded first price to a rival peddler by the name of “Rambo”, who delivered the most heartfelt and vocally impeccable performance of the night.

The Admiralty of the Liechtenstein Princely Navy would like to congratulate AIA Southside Massive for putting together an excellent party and raising money for a good cause.
